Blazor 还支持通过组件进行 UI 封装。 组件具有以下特点: 是自包含的 UI 块。 维护自己的状态和呈现逻辑。 可以定义 UI 事件处理程序、绑定到输入数据以及管理其自己的生命周期。 通常使用 Razor 语法在 .razor 文件中定义。 Razor 简介 Razor 是基于 HTML 和 C# 的轻量级标记模板化语言。 借助 Razor,可以在标记...
但作为基于Web Assembly的前端框架,它依然还是特别的:WASM的普及和发展,一定会利及Blazor,使其在未来有更大的发展空间。这里举一个即将实现的例子:由于WASM可以在非Web环境下运行,那么Blazor将来也可以用于开发运行在非Web环境下的UI程序,这在官方的计划中已经提及——Blazor Web Assembly MAUI。 上文出处:https://...
10款值得推荐的Blazor UI组件库 前言经常看到有小伙伴在DotNetGuide技术社区交流群里问有什么好用的Blazor UI组件库推荐的,本文将分享一些开源、实用、美观的Blazor UI组件库,提供给广大C#/.NET开发者们学习和使用( 注… 追逐时光者发表于C#/.N... 如何用 Blazor 实现 Ant Design 组件库? James...发表于Blazo...
Blazor是一个使用 .NET框架和C#编程语言Razor语法构建Web应用程序的UI框架,它可以用于构建单页应用(SPA)和 Web服务,它使用编译的C#来操纵HTML DOM来替代JavaScript。Blazor 的目标是让开发人员使用C#编程语言来编写 Web 应用程序,使得C#程序员可以在一个熟悉的编程语言中完成整个应用程序的开发。这样既可以提高开发效率,...
Blazorise 是用于Blazor的 UI 组件库,支持使用Bootstrap、Tailwind、Bulma、Ant Design 和 Material 等 CSS 框架,可用于构建响应式的单页 Web 应用程序。 项目截图 Microsoft Fluent UI Blazor 使用文档:fluentui-blazor.net/GitHub项目地址:github.com/microsoft/fl 项目介绍 Microsoft Fluent UI Blazor是一个基于Blazor...
DevExpress Blazor UI组件使用了C#为Blazor Server和Blazor WebAssembly创建高影响力的用户体验,这个UI自建库提供了一套全面的原生Blazor UI组件(包括Pivot Grid、调度程序、图表、数据编辑器和报表等)。DevExpress Blazor控件目前已经升级到v24.1版本了,此版本发布了全新文件输入组件、Drawer组件、Toast组件等,欢迎下载...
在Blazor 中,从名为“组件”的自包含代码部分生成 UI。 每个组件都可以包含 HTML 和 C# 代码的混合。 组件是通过使用 Razor 语法编写的,其中的代码是用@code指令标记的。 其他指令可用于访问变量、绑定到值以及实现其他呈现任务。 编译应用时,HTML 和代码将编译为组件类...
前言 今天大姚给大家分享一个由微软官方开源(MIT License)、免费的Blazor UI组件库:Fluent UI Blazor。 全面的ASP.NET Core Blazor简介和快速入门 Fluent UI Blazor介绍 Fluent UI Blazor是一个基于Blazor的组件库,
Blazor是一个使用 .NET框架和C#编程语言Razor语法构建Web应用程序的UI框架,它可以用于构建单页应用(SPA)和 Web服务,它使用编译的C#来操纵HTML DOM来替代JavaScript。Blazor 的目标是让开发人员使用C#编程语言来编写 Web 应用程序,使得C#程序员可以在一个熟悉的编程语言中完成整个应用程序的开发。这样既可以提高开发效率...
全新的渲染引擎 下面的DevExpress Blazor组件现在使用我们优化的渲染引擎(替代Bootstrap):ChartsRich Text EditorSchedulerPivot GridUploadReport Viewer 键盘支持 为了解决可访问性标准并改善用户体验,v24.1为以下DevExpress Blazor UI组件添加了键盘导航支持:Date EditTime EditTree ViewAccordionComboBoxList BoxTagBox...